Here is the playlist for Marcus’ story. This was kind of tricky because there is not much in the way of events to hang your hat on. I mostly chose songs whose title fit elements of the story.



* Elvis Costello – Pretty Words – It sounds like it was not so much the pictures in Cerebus that atracted Marcus’ interest, but the words. This song edges out THe Monkees’ “Words” as my favourite words song.
* Serge Gainsbourg – Comic Strip – I have no idea what he is singing in this song. The title implies it’s about comic strips, but, lket’s face it, it’s a Serge Gainsbourg songs so it’s probably about sex.
* No Fun – Me – Probably the song that best sums up the auto-bio comics scene of which Ian’s I was one of the best.
* The Beach Boys – Friends – A song all about the warm, longtime relationships on Facebook, full of warm memories and hard won life experiences.
* Cub – Main and Broadway – Marcus’ mysterious love of Canada is now somewhat sated by the little podcast that comes from the neighbourhood namechecked in this ditty.

If you like the idea of English folk music combined with Southern-style boogie and a healthy dose of prog-rock, then you might enjoy Wolf People. For sure try to catch them if they play live in your area.

Gotta love those dual leads!
